Common LiftMaster Garage Door Problems We Solve in Palmdale

  • MyQ Wi-Fi module failure from UV degradation. Palmdale’s relentless high-desert sun cracks the antenna housing seal on LiftMaster MyQ modules, letting dust and moisture destroy the connection. The app goes offline even though the door opens fine from the wall button. We replace the module with an OEM unit and apply a UV-resistant sealant that the factory doesn’t include.
  • Trolley carriage wear on chain-drive models. Wind-rated doors in Palmdale weigh significantly more than standard panels. The 8360W-267 Belleville and similar chain-drive units experience accelerated trolley wear from that extra mass, producing jerky operation or a complete jam mid-cycle. We install reinforced aftermarket trolleys and recalibrate force settings for the actual door weight.
  • Logic board capacitor failure in older 3800 series units. Palmdale’s sub-freezing January nights followed by rapid summer heating cook the capacitors in wall-mount openers installed during the 1990s housing boom. The LCD goes blank or the motor won’t power on. We stock replacement logic boards and can typically swap them same-day.
  • Safety sensor misalignment from track expansion. A 40°F morning-to-afternoon temperature swing in Palmdale causes steel track to expand and contract enough to knock LiftMaster safety reversing sensors out of alignment. The door reverses unexpectedly or refuses to close. We realign, secure the brackets with thread-locking compound, and check the full track run for stress points.
  • Belt drive failure in extreme cold. Last winter, we responded to a call on Sierra Highway near Avenue P where the resident’s LiftMaster 8500W had stopped working after a 26°F night. The wall-mount unit’s belt drive had snapped - not a common failure elsewhere, but the extreme overnight freeze combined with a heavy steel wind-rated door had made the belt brittle. We replaced it with a reinforced Kevlar belt, recalibrated the force settings, and added a MyQ hub firmware update to restore remote access; the homeowner was back in business before the afternoon winds picked up.

LiftMaster Service in Palmdale: What Local Conditions Mean for Your Equipment

Because Palmdale lies in a high desert with strong Santa Ana winds that can gust over 70 mph, LiftMaster openers on wind-rated doors require special spring tension calculations - standard torque settings from the factory often need adjustment to prevent cable slack and premature spring failure in this unique wind corridor. The tract homes built during the 1980s-2000s Antelope Valley population boom, concentrated in ZIP codes like 93550 and 93552, mostly got two- or three-car attached garages with doors now hitting 25-35 years of age. Those original spring setups were calculated for standard wind loads, not the reality of living in a funnel between the Tehachapi Pass and the Mojave Desert.

We’ve measured the difference. A LiftMaster 8500W on a 16-foot wind-rated door in Rancho Vista needs roughly 15% higher spring tension than the same installation in Pasadena to maintain proper cable tension when a 50-mph gust hits. Get it wrong and the opener’s motor strains, the trolley wears fast, and the homeowner gets a $400 repair that should have been a $180 adjustment. Palmdale’s extreme diurnal temperature swings - freezing overnight lows in January through 100°F+ summer afternoons - degrade rubber bottom seals, weatherstripping, and nylon roller bearings far faster than the San Fernando Valley. The UV chalks and cracks painted steel panels within years rather than decades. If the door isn’t moving right, something isn’t set right - and that’s always a fixable problem.

FAQs - LiftMaster Garage Door in Palmdale

My LiftMaster MyQ app says ‘Offline’ even when my garage door works locally - is it the Wi-Fi module?

Yes, most likely. In Palmdale’s high-desert UV environment, the MyQ module’s antenna housing seal degrades and cracks, allowing dust and moisture to interrupt the Wi-Fi connection while the local radio link between opener and wall button keeps working. We replace the module with an OEM unit and apply additional weatherproofing. Call (855) 574-1819 - we’ll confirm with a quick diagnostic and give you a firm repair quote.

Why do my LiftMaster safety sensors keep blinking even after I cleaned the lenses?

Palmdale’s extreme daily temperature swings cause track expansion and contraction that knocks sensors out of alignment. Cleaning the lenses fixes obstruction issues, not mechanical drift. We realign the brackets, secure them properly, and check whether your track mounting needs reinforcement for local conditions.

Do I really need a wind-rated door with my LiftMaster opener in Palmdale?

If you’re in the Antelope Valley wind corridor, yes. Standard doors and factory torque settings aren’t calculated for 50-70 mph gusts. A wind-rated door with properly tensioned springs protects both your property and your opener’s motor and trolley from overload failure. We assess your specific exposure and door age during our free estimate.

My LiftMaster remote won’t program even after following the manual - is there a trick?

There’s no trick, but there are common causes: a logic board with capacitor damage from Palmdale’s temperature extremes, interference from LED bulbs in the garage, or a remote on the wrong frequency after a neighbor’s new installation. We diagnose the actual cause rather than walking you through generic steps that don’t apply. Call (855) 574-1819 and we’ll sort it out.

How often should I replace my LiftMaster opener’s battery backup in the high desert?

Every 2-3 years in Palmdale’s climate. The same temperature extremes that degrade other components shorten battery life significantly compared to coastal California. We test battery health during every service call and stock replacements for 8500W and 8160W units. Call (855) 574-1819 to schedule a quick check.
